 Description   

I have inserted an object into my database that contains an emoji, but when I try a query to find that object with that emoji it will not find it.

When I use code to get that object (Without specifying the emoji but using the other key of that object) and compare the emoji to the object's emoji it will say it's equal.

I expect to be able to find an object by a given emoji.

Images are shown as proof.

Comment by Edwin Zhou [ 12/Oct/20 ]

Hi gerdon262@gmail.com,

Thank you providing further clarification to your issue. There doesn't seem to be support for querying emojis in the Atlas web interface but there is support in the mongo shell and Compass. Since this is an Atlas related issue, I've passed your bug report along to the Atlas team.

The SERVER project is for bugs and feature suggestions for the MongoDB server. Comment by Gerdon Abbink [ 12/Oct/20 ]

Hi Edwin,

Thanks for trying but it's still not working for me. The whitespace is added when I trying to edit the value (flag emoji).

I have tried another emoji, but this didn't work either.

Comment by Edwin Zhou [ 12/Oct/20 ]

Hi gerdon262@gmail.com,

I was able to reproduce your issue and looks like you added white space to the end of the name field that prevents your filter query from matching the document.
